Type
ORACLE
Validation date
2023-10-06 17:12: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03808,
    "usd": 0.04111
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001E2B3BDAD487DC0453CBB4A287FA68F83AEECFF5EF23CAF2F9393EE080B957E5C

Previous signature

5487B7B11A9BB8A505434BFF5B21AB5309756580DE3C01DA2E159328EFA030F40CA2767E291A0FAF6BCABF68ADF7B66B8CE4FE6008669AAB23ACD46C778F0E01

Origin signature

304402206DD903D8114A944B14BFA404F515A93B0D80BC7C80AF35055859CEF64B2FDA69022051CB3E40727DFC751E260ED67C7E0ABB96793D9C984F4398B06024B6C43537F0

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

005472374D1F1276DE3A7CD85EC9C312526E34B442AB7B711648215A5C37809EB7

Coordinator signature

63449ED176A71E0B45E1154CAD38C44C5DB6429105798FE8B49FF3C2D5E907E66063C601AF1EA41861A8A8A1279F7084308165886C341C241F6F6BF666CDBA0D

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

7655D0D09894930A1195976908F9496FA8834E0E859C3B6BF6C2BC80CC4ED245AE8817EA82D6146088AB15D93D8BF1140C30CBCF8DC5A3137783993BC648D70D

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

CE0F823273BEDBFD277D934022A808DEC843F3E3C8E579347B88FDE1B10133A9D078AF39685B39429EFE076865B46A5B9F921E24044894151B3F651C8F0F7C08